I am trying to enable X.M.P. from BIOS ( 32GB RAM DDR5 6400 MHZ) from 4000 MHZ base to 6400 MHZ on a ROG STRIX B760-F GAMING WIFI motherboard.
The problem Is everytime i try to enable X.M.P. and i save and reset from BIOS ,monitor goes black screen and the computer doesn't restart.I must turn off computer and restart It ..i directly go to the BIOS and i have to disable X.M.P. to return on Windows...THAT'S IT!! If you're able to exchange it, I would. Look for Samsung IC kits on the QVL list on the support site.
Overclocking is not guaranteed, it may also be you have a weak memory controller (CPU).

The applied overclock is unstable so failing memory training. You can try the following,
Ensure modules are in slots A2 and B2.
XMP II Profile. This contains more relaxed sub timings and is the default DIMM profile.
Increase Memory Controller Voltage (Advanced Memory Voltages) Try values between 1.25 to 1.35v.
Adjust VCCSA (CPU System Agent Voltage). Try values between 1.0 - 1.3v
Increase VDD / VDDQ voltage by 20mV
